Wallets that are pricey but at least more affordable than the above category (betw SGD1-3k):

Bottega Veneta Intrecciato Classic Wallet
Oh ... this leather is soooo buttery soft, you will never want to stop stroking it. And the version I saw didn't have a zip for the coin compartment, Instead, it had a very lovely old-fashioned purse-like clasp, which I absolutely adore. I've been noticing that zips seem to adorn most of the current collection of wallets, so it's been tough finding a wallet with a purse clasp. This wallet can hold loads of cards. My only grouse is that it has only one notes compartment. I'd prefer at least 2 notes compartments to segregate my notes and receipts.

Loewe Continental Wallet from the Anagram Signature Line
This is in boxcalf which feels like pretty hardy leather and has a nice leathery feel. It also has 3 notes compartment which I like cos I like to segregate my notes to ensure similar coloured notes with very different denominations do not get mixed up. And I like the third compartment for receipts. In terms of compartments, I really like this one. If I do get it, what colour do I get?
